Hello my love! Today we are taking our Pilates to the next level with a full body sculpting workouts. Expect a full-body burn that leaves you feeling strong, centered, and sculpted.
This energising class starts with light wrist weights to tone and sculpt the arms, shoulders, and upper back—hello graceful posture. We are using the pilates ball to challenge our balance and stability with focused Pilates sequences to lengthen and tone the butt and thighs. Then we take it to the mat with the Pilates ball to fire up the inner thighs and deeply engage your core.
When we use the Pilates ball under the feet, it needs to be deflated for you to balance on it - make sure to let some air out and that it is sealed before stepping onto the ball and ensure you feel in control of the movements. This is challenging so if it gets to be too advanced at any point, you can do all the exercises without the ball.
EQUIPMENT: 1 lb ankle weights & pilates ball (optional)
